Transaction

574604f8d56d2f08bcd37aa9dfa7d95ffaa18de7a616c2fd2b6b91a88443fb62
297,169 confirmations
Timestamp
1595665783
Block640,698
Fee151,700 sats
Fee rate170.1 sats/vB
view on mempool.space

Inputs & Outputs